Caravan Palace are the French band that turned electro-swing into a global phenomenon, formed in Paris in 2008 and blending the hot jazz of 1930s Django Reinhardt and Cab Calloway with modern house, electro and dubstep. Their self-titled debut and later albums — home to viral hits like "Lone Digger" and "Suzy" — splice swinging double bass, gypsy-jazz guitar and brass with punchy programmed beats, wobbling synths and chopped vintage vocal samples. Fronted by the playful, retro-tinged vocals of Zoe Colotis, the group pairs Roaring-Twenties glamour with a sleek electronic dancefloor drive, a sound as at home in a speakeasy as in a modern club. Their striking animated videos helped turn tracks into internet sensations. The signature is vibrant electro-swing — bouncing swing rhythms, manouche guitar and hot brass laid over four-on-the-floor beats and gritty bass, topped with cheeky vintage-flavoured vocals.
